3. How to File a DMCA Takedown Notice
If you are the copyright owner or an authorized agent, submit a DMCA takedown notice by emailing contact@architegram.com with the following details:
✔ Your Contact Information:
- Full name
- Email address
- Phone number
- Physical mailing address
✔ Identification of the Copyrighted Work:
- A description of the copyrighted content (e.g., title, creation date, registration number if applicable).
- A link to the original copyrighted work (if available).
✔ Identification of the Infringing Material:
- A direct URL or a screenshot clearly showing the infringing content on Architegram.com.
✔ Good Faith Statement:
- A statement asserting your good faith belief that the use of the material is not authorized by the copyright owner, its agent, or the law.
✔ Statement Under Penalty of Perjury:
- A declaration that the information in your notice is accurate and that you are either the copyright owner or authorized to act on behalf of the owner.
✔ Your Signature:
- A physical or electronic signature.
📌 Note: Incomplete DMCA notices will not be processed. Please ensure that all required details are provided for a prompt review.
4. How We Handle DMCA Complaints
✔ We will review the claim and may temporarily remove or disable access to the allegedly infringing content.
✔ We will notify the user responsible for the content and provide them with an opportunity to submit a counter-notice if they believe the removal was in error.
✔ If no valid counter-notice is received, the content will remain removed.
✔ If a counter-notice is filed, we will forward it to the original complainant, who may then take further legal action if necessary.
✔ Enforcement: We reserve the right to terminate the accounts of repeat infringers.
5. Filing a Counter-Notice
If you believe that your content was removed in error due to misidentification or a false DMCA claim, you may submit a counter-notice by emailing contact@architegram.com with the following details:
✔ Your Contact Information:
- Full name
- Email address
- Phone number
✔ Identification of the Removed Content:
- The specific URL or location where the removed content previously appeared.
✔ Good Faith Statement:
- A statement indicating that you have a good faith belief that the content was removed as a result of mistake or misidentification.
✔ Consent to Jurisdiction:
- A statement consenting to the jurisdiction of the courts in the United Kingdom and agreeing to accept service of process from the complainant.
✔ Your Signature:
- A physical or electronic signature.
📌 Note: If we receive a valid counter-notice and the original complainant does not initiate legal proceedings within 14 days, we may restore the removed content.
